I need a scource of new curtain material for the older Graflex cameras like the RBs. The material that came out was .015 thick, and the materail I have is .008. I really don't want to try and add to the materal I have, as I have tried this, and it is a bit cludgey.
Any Idea where I can get .015 thick curtain material?

Use the .008 you have. The original thickness may have been .006. All Graflex/Graphic cameras use the same curtain material and it swells with age and as it dries out.
Too thick of a material will not roll up into the body opening at the top, bottom, or both. Too stiff a material will not move through the camera easily resulting in excessive initial tension and loss of shutter speeds. _________________ The best camera ever made is the one that YOU enjoy using and produces the image quality that satifies YOU. |

Are you measuring the thickness where the apertures are or the rolled up
ends of the shutter fabric on the rollers ?
.015 seems thick, my 1940"s RB measured .10 thick where the fabric
was well protected on the rollers, that part of the shutter fabric was the
most pristine to take a measurement from.
Player Piano Company has it in .008 ( black ) but the .010 which they
also have isn't black unfortunately, I did find some .012 fabric in a
local store but it's too stiff compared to the OEM fabric . |
